TRANSPORTATION SERVICES FOR STUDENTS



Transportation services, although not required for students other than Special Education as determined by the IEP Team, are provided as a service to the general population based on Tennessee State Law and Shelby County School Board Policies 3009 through 3012. A summary of these policies is stated below.

Eligibility
Students who reside one and one-half (1 1/2) miles or more from their assigned schools are provided transportation by school bus to and from school. Transportation is also provided for academic field trips in direct support of the curriculum and for support of the co-curricular programs (athletics, music, drama, etc.).

All students riding special transportation and students riding a regular bus who have physical/medical needs must have a completed Student Information Form on file at the school and the Transportation Office. The form can be obtained at the student's school office and must be updated twice yearly. A copy of the Student Information Form will be provided to the bus driver.

Students who have a current IEP (Individual Education Program) indicating a need for special transportation services will be provided transportation to school. The student will attend their home school whenever possible. If an appropriate program is not available at the home school, school placement will be determined by the IEP team. Equipment needs and/or special accommodations will be determined by the IEP team. NOTE: Students attending school due to a transfer request granted by Pupil Services are not eligible for transportation services.
